Selman's Stages
A theory outlining the development of social perspective-taking in children, which involves understanding others' thoughts and feelings from multiple viewpoints.
Friendship
A close and mutual bond between two people, characterized by affection, trust, and support.
Intimate
Characterized by a close, personal, and private nature, often referring to relationships or encounters between individuals.
Autonomous Interdependence
A state in which individuals are self-governing and make their own decisions, yet still remain connected and considerate of the relationships they have with others.
